Overview
Uranus in Scorpio plunges the revolution into the deep waters of power, sexuality, death, taboo, and transformation. Uranus, the planet of revolution, awakening, sudden change, technology, and freedom, meets Scorpio, the fixed water sign of Pluto, intensity, and the underworld. This generational placement produces people who break open everything humans have tried to keep buried. Uranus most recently transited Scorpio from approximately 1975 to 1981, the era of the AIDS crisis emerging, the sexual revolution maturing into harder questions, the rise of psychotherapy as cultural force, the explosion of investigative journalism uncovering political corruption, the early environmental movement confronting industrial poisoning, and a profound cultural reckoning with death, addiction, and shadow.

The previous cycle from 1891 to 1898 saw Freud beginning his work on the unconscious, the rise of psychoanalysis, early labor uprisings, and the discovery of radioactivity. Uranus in Scorpio natives carry the imprint of intense awakening to the hidden forces that shape human life. They tend to feel a deep call toward truth-telling, especially the kind of truth that has been suppressed, denied, or weaponized. They rebel against secrecy that protects the powerful, against sexual repression, against the pretense that death and shadow do not exist.

Their generational task is to liberate the underworld of human experience, to bring what has been hidden into transformative light. They are the therapists, the journalists, the addiction recovery pioneers, the sexual health revolutionaries, the conspiracy investigators, and the artists who make the unspeakable speakable. The shadow is paranoia, manipulation, and the addiction to crisis. At their best, this generation becomes the alchemists who transform collective trauma into wisdom.
